Minderbroeders Observanten

Reforms in the 15th century resulted in a new movement, the Franciscanen Observanten. The Franciscans who did not follow this movement were called the Franciscanen Conventuelen.

* Lichtenberg near Maastricht, Klooster Slavante
* Tongeren, Minderbroedersklooster (founded 1626)

Unidentified Franciscan books

* NL-DHk 74 G 10, week psalter, mid 15th century, prepared at klooster Siloe for a Franciscan women's house
* NL-DHk 71 A 7, Week psalter, canticles and hymns, for a Franciscan house in or near Maastricht
* NL-Uu 427, Franciscan or Clarissen breviary; 2nd half 15th century
* B-Br 6434 (cat.nr. 695), Franciscan antiphoner from the diocese of Luik, 15th century
